Miniature Schnauzer vs Spinone Italiano
You might be comparing a Miniature Schnauzer and a Spinone Italiano because you want a loyal, family-friendly dog that doesn’t shed much. but that’s where the obvious similarities end. One is a compact, feisty little watchdog with a salt-and-pepper beard and opinions on everything. The other is a big, soft-eyed Italian hunting dog built like a draft horse, with floppy ears and drool to spare. The Miniature Schnauzer fits in apartments, thrives on routine and training, and will alert you to every passing squirrel, mail carrier, and shadow. They’re sharp, eager to please, and great with kids, but they need grooming every six weeks and they will bark. If you want a dog that feels like a furry security system with a high IQ, this is your breed. The Spinone is the opposite kind of quiet. Gentle, patient, and deeply attached to their people, they’re happiest when hiking, hunting, or lumbering around a big yard. They’re not as quick to train, but their steady temperament is gold for families who aren’t looking for a circus act. Just know: they need space, they slobber, and their long ears are prone to infections. Here’s the real talk: Miniature Schnauzers are often chosen by first-time owners who don’t realize how much attention they demand. They’re not just small dogs. they’re terriers with volume knobs set to eleven. Spinones, meanwhile, are underdogs in popularity for a reason. They’re not flashy or fast, but if you value calm loyalty over tricks and barks, they’ll quietly steal your heart. Pick the Schnauzer if you want a compact, clever companion who thrives on structure. Pick the Spinone if you’ve got room to roam and want a soulful, rugged partner who loves deeply and asks for little. except your time.
